Marks Sattin Executive Search is working with a prestigious Family Office based in central London, supporting the search for a highly capable Senior Investment Accountant to join their dynamic and growing finance function.
This is a broad, hands-on role offering exposure across investment vehicles, property companies, partnerships, and trusts. The successful candidate will support ongoing finance transformation work, including system improvements. You will be responsible for management and regulatory reporting, performance analysis across multiple currencies, and helping drive greater financial insight. This is a key role within a lean team, requiring a detail-oriented, commercially aware individual with a strong technical background and the ability to roll up their sleeves where needed.
You will also support bank reporting, external audits, and liaise with key third parties, including property managers and banks. As a senior member of the team, you\’ll review and guide the work of junior accountants and contribute to process improvement across the department.
The Ideal Candidate
- A fully qualified accountant (ACA, ACCA, or ACMA), Ideally chartered
- Ideally experienced in investment or property accounting, with exposure to partnerships and trusts.
- Strong technical grounding in management and statutory accounts preparation.
- Proficient in Excel, with a strong grasp of financial systems and data.
- Able to build effective relationships with internal teams and external stakeholders, including property managers and banks.
- Hands-on, detail-oriented, and confident reviewing junior team members\’ work.
- Adaptable, commercially aware, and able to respond at pace to evolving priorities.
- Family office , Asset Management , Hedge fund, Private equity or Fund/Investment accounting experience is desirable.
